The functionality can be done entirely in userspace with a combination of mmap + memcpy 2. The only reason anyone in userspace is still using it is because someone implemented bo_subdata that way in libdrm ages ago and they're all too lazy to write the 5 lines of code to do a map. 3. This falls cleanly into the category of things which will only get more painful with local memory support. These ioctls aren't used much anymore by "real" userspace drivers. Vulkan has never used them and neither has the iris GL driver. The old i965 GL driver does use PWRITE for glBufferSubData but it only supports up through Gen11; Gen12 was never enabled in i965. The compute driver has never used PREAD/PWRITE. The only remaining user is the media driver which uses it exactly twice and they're easily removed [1] so expecting them to drop it going forward is reasonable. IGT changes which handle this kernel change have also been submitted [2].
